Advanced Modular Radial Head Replacement Arthroplasty in Complex Elbow Trauma
The human elbow joint is a highly sophisticated trochoid ginglymus hinge, where the proximal radioulnar and radiohumeral articulations govern essential forearm pronation, supination, and valgus load stability. When severe trauma occurs—specifically Mason Type III (comminuted non-reconstructable fractures) and Mason Type IV fractures accompanied by elbow dislocation—primary internal fixation frequently fails to provide mechanical integrity. In such acute clinical scenarios, primary radial head resection without prosthetic replacement triggers severe secondary complications, including proximal migration of the radius, longitudinal radioulnar instability (Essex-Lopresti lesion), and valgus instability due to compromised medial collateral ligament (MCL) tensions.

By leveraging advanced anatomical mapping, our systems replicate the native radiocapitellar dish depth, stem offset, and neck-shaft angle, ensuring smooth kinematic motion across all degrees of elbow flexion and forearm rotation.
Our modular radial head prosthetic systems feature a smooth articulating head coupled with a choice of press-fit textured titanium alloy stems (Ti6Al4V ELI) or polished cementable stem geometries. The micro-roughness of the porous plasma-sprayed coating on the stem collar promotes long-term secondary osseointegration, while preventing stress shielding in the proximal radial neck region.

Medical device distribution in Serbia is tightly governed by the Medicines and Medical Devices Agency of Serbia (ALIMS - Agencija za lekove i medicinska sredstva Srbije). To legally place Class IIb and Class III orthopedic implants on the Serbian market, manufacturers must supply comprehensive Technical Files adhering to European Union Medical Device Regulation (EU-MDR 2017/745) frameworks.

How does your factory prevent "overstuffing" of the radiocapitellar joint during surgery?
Overstuffing leads to capitellar erosion, joint stiffness, and severe pain. Our radial head system addresses this by providing fine-tuned modularity: head heights starting from 8mm and neck extension collars (+0mm, +2mm, +4mm, +6mm). Additionally, anatomical radiocapitellar trial components allow surgeons to verify tension against the lateral collateral ligament before selecting final implants.

What biocompatible materials are utilized in your radial head replacement heads and stems?
Radial head articulation components are manufactured from high-purity Cobalt-Chromium-Molybdenum alloy (CoCrMo per ISO 5832-4 / ASTM F75), polished to mirror finishes. Stems are crafted from high-strength Titanium Alloy (Ti6Al4V ELI per ISO 5832-3 / ASTM F136), available with plasma-sprayed porous titanium coating for press-fit fixation or polished for bone cement application.
